Prerequisites to install DevOps Test Hub on Ubuntu
You must complete certain tasks before you install HCL DevOps Test Hub (Test Hub) on the Ubuntu platform.
The following sections describe prerequisites in detail:
Internet access
You must have access to the internet to install Test Hub.
Ubuntu Server
You must install the supported version of Ubuntu Server and have a working Domain Name Server (DNS) that resolves the hostname into a machine-readable IP address.
For more information about specific versions of software requirements, see System Requirements for DevOps Test Hub 2024.03 (11.0.1).
Backup of user data
If you want to upgrade Test Hub from a previous version, then you must perform one of the following tasks based on the existing version of Test Hub:
-
Back up the data from V10.0.2, Fix Pack 1 or earlier. See Backing up the user data from a previous release.
-
Back up the data from V10.1.0 or later. See Backing up DevOps Test Hub data on Ubuntu.Note: You must select the existing version of Test Hub from the drop-down list to view the procedure to back up and restore the user data for your version because the instructions differ for different versions.
Mandatory software
You must install the following mandatory software:
-
Helm. For more information, refer to the Helm documentation. For more information about specific versions of software requirements, see System Requirements for DevOps Test Hub 2024.03 (11.0.1).Note: The Helm command must be in one of the directories in your PATH environment variable.
-
OpenSSH Server. For more information, refer to the Installation section in the OpenSSH Server documentation.
Note: If you use ssh to log in to the computer, then you can skip this step because OpenSSH is already installed on your computer.